De Ketelaere near perfect as Belgium beat United States 4-1, Balogun anonymous

Artikelbild:De Ketelaere near perfect as Belgium beat United States 4-1, Balogun anonymous

Charles De Ketelaere ran the World Cup last-16 tie as Belgium beat the United States 4-1, involved in the first three goals and scoring twice. According to L'Équipe, he was rated eight, while Folarin Balogun was criticised for a subdued outing.

On nine minutes De Ketelaere followed in Nicolas Raskin’s cross-shot to open the scoring. The United States levelled from a set-piece, then on 33 minutes he nodded in to restore Belgium’s lead.

His pressing unsettled goalkeeper Matt Freese on 57 minutes, allowing Hans Vanaken to add the third for 3-1. De Ketelaere’s hold-up play and work without the ball kept Belgium high up the pitch.

He made way for Romelu Lukaku on 67 minutes. Lukaku repeatedly stretched the defence, then struck in 90+3 to complete the 4-1 scoreline, his third goal of the tournament.

Raskin took seven for relentless ball-winning that set the tone. Leandro Trossard earned seven after supplying De Ketelaere’s second with a sharp burst down the left. Dodi Lukebakio received six for pace and defensive graft before Jeremy Doku replaced him on 67.

For the United States, Freese was marked three after the mistake before Belgium’s third. Antonee Robinson also scored three, often exposed by Lukebakio, while Tim Ream was given two after a torrid night in key duels and slow distribution. Balogun received three, largely quiet apart from a late effort saved by Thibaut Courtois on 82.
